How Do Ear Hair Cells Operate in the Detection of Sound?

Ear hair cells function by responding to sound waves that traverse the ear canal. When these sound waves reach the cochlea, they cause movement in the fluid inside, which in turn bends the stereocilia of the hair cells. This bending opens ion channels that generate nerve impulses, which are then transmitted via the auditory nerve to the brain. This intricate mechanism allows us to differentiate between numerous sounds and comprehend speech. The mechanical actions of the stereocilia are converted into electrical signals, enabling the brain to interpret these signals as sound. This complex interplay highlights the delicate nature of ear hair cells and their irreplaceable contribution to auditory perception.

What Are the Implications of Ear Hair Cell Death on Hearing?

The demise of ear hair cells results in a significant reduction in hearing capability, frequently culminating in permanent hearing loss. Various factors contribute to the death of these cells, including aging, exposure to loud noises, and the consumption of certain ototoxic medications. Once an ear hair cell ceases to function, it cannot regenerate, resulting in the auditory system lacking a crucial component necessary for sound transduction. The ramifications of this cell death can be severe; even a limited number of damaged hair cells can drastically affect auditory perception. Individuals may experience difficulty in understanding speech, especially in noisy environments, or may develop a condition known as tinnitus, characterised by a persistent ringing or buzzing sensation in the ears.

Can Ear Hair Cells Regenerate on Their Own?

Unlike certain species, such as birds and fish, which possess the remarkable ability to regenerate hair cells after damage, humans lack this regenerative capability. Once ear hair cells become damaged, they do not regrow, leading to irreversible hearing impairment. However, ongoing research is diligently investigating potential treatments, focusing on strategies such as gene therapy and stem cell research aimed at stimulating the regeneration of these crucial cells in humans. While the prospects for such treatments remain hopeful, current understanding underscores that prevention is the most effective strategy for maintaining ear health.

What Are the Most Recent Innovations in Hearing Treatments?

When ear hair cells sustain damage, the available treatment options primarily encompass hearing aids and cochlear implants. Hearing aids help to amplify sounds, assisting users in hearing better in a variety of situations, while cochlear implants bypass damaged hair cells entirely, directly stimulating the auditory nerve. Effectively managing hearing loss necessitates consulting with audiologists to identify suitable devices and tailor them to meet individual requirements. For those experiencing significant auditory impairments, pursuing these solutions can greatly enhance communication and improve overall quality of life, compensating for the loss of natural hearing function.

How Does Hearing Loss Develop Over Time?

Hearing loss can occur gradually or suddenly, depending on the underlying cause. In cases related to aging, individuals may observe a slow decline over several years, often attributed to cumulative cell damage. Conversely, noise-induced hearing loss may present itself suddenly following exposure to loud sounds. The progression of hearing loss is typically categorised into stages: mild, moderate, severe, and profound. Understanding these stages aids individuals in recognising their condition and determining when to seek professional help. Monitoring changes in hearing over time is vital for timely intervention and effective management.

What Assistive Devices Are Available to Enhance Hearing?

Assistive devices, including hearing aids and cochlear implants, play a vital role in improving the quality of life for individuals facing hearing loss. Hearing aids amplify sound, making it easier to comprehend conversations and environmental noises. In contrast, cochlear implants bypass damaged hair cells, directly stimulating the auditory nerve to create the sensation of sound. Understanding how these devices function empowers individuals to select the most suitable option for their requirements, thereby enhancing their ability to engage with their surroundings.
